我在通过REST API刷新Power BI数据集时遇到问题。
每当我尝试执行dataset刷新API时,都会收到此错误:
上次刷新失败:...没有可用的网关。
我在两个账户上测试,这只发生在其中一个账户上。
更令人困惑的是,我使用的存储是基于云的(Azure数据湖)。所以它不需要网关连接。当我手动刷新数据集时,它可以正常工作。
当我获得更多investigationI的刷新历史记录时,获取以下内容:
serviceExceptionJson={"errorCode":"DMTS_MonikerWithUnboundDataSources"}
我需要任何人的帮助。
发布于 2020-06-11 16:03:20
我已经找到了一个变通的解决方案,尽管我不太相信这是问题的根源(也许原因对我来说仍然很模糊)
首先,为了了解更多上下文,这是我正在做的(使用API):
1-将数据集上传到工作区(导入pbix并跳过报告,我只需要其中的参数和power查询)
2-更新参数
3-刷新数据集
问题是,我有一个参数来表示datalake数据的url。根据用例/用户的不同,url有两个值。
因此,我所做的就是删除该参数,并创建两个不同的pbix,每个pbix都有其特定的url。因此,我将根据用例导入一个pbix。
我仍然不明白为什么我得到一个网关错误,而我应该得到“error while processing data”消息(看起来这似乎是一个数据访问问题)。
https://stackoverflow.com/questions/62299774
复制相似问题